This week’s meeting topic was all about fiber. Yep…we talked about poop and the digestive system. It wasn’t totally about poop but there was quite a bit of poop talk going on.

It was a very interesting topic. Did you know that women are supposed to have 25 grams of fiber in a day and men are supposed to have 38? That is a heck of a lot of fiber.

IF you eat your 4 servings of fruit and veggies with an additional two servings, you have met the requirement. If you are like me, you don’t get your 4 servings so that is not happening.

I also learned that corn has a higher fiber serving than brown rice. That was surprising to me! One food rich in fiber is black beans. Try and add black beans to more recipes to get more fiber in your diet.
